Как узнать точную метку времени файла в миллисекундах?

Разница в атрибутах времени файлов: ExFAT и NTFS

Когда дело доходит до хранения и управления файлами в операционных системах Windows, важно учитывать разные файловые системы. В частности, ExFAT и NTFS имеют разные подходы к хранению атрибутов времени файла. В этой статье мы рассмотрим, как ExFAT и NTFS обрабатывают время создания, последнего доступа и последнего изменения файлов, а также как можно просматривать эти атрибуты.

Атрибуты времени в ExFAT и NTFS

Файловая система ExFAT (Extended File Allocation Table) хранит атрибуты времени с разрешением 10 миллисекунд. В противовес этому, файловая система NTFS (New Technology File System) предоставляет более высокую точность, сохраняя время с разрешением 100 наносекунд. Это отличие может сыграть роль в ситуациях, когда требуется высокая точность временных отметок.

Просмотр атрибутов времени файла в Windows

Чтобы просмотреть атрибуты времени файла в Windows, можно воспользоваться PowerShell — мощным инструментом для управления системой и автоматизации задач. Давайте рассмотрим, как это сделать.

Использование PowerShell для получения информации о времени файла

Откройте PowerShell и выполните следующий код:

$file = Get-Item .\test.txt
$file.CreationTimeUtc.ToString("o")

В этом примере мы получаем атрибут времени создания файла test.txt. Результат будет выведен в формате ISO 8601, что делает его легким для понимания и использования в других приложениях.

Пример вывода

При выполнении команды, вы можете получить следующий вывод:

2025-01-13T09:48:28.1388492Z

Этот вывод показывает дату и время в формате, который удобно анализировать как людьми, так и программами.

Доступ к другим атрибутам времени файла

Кроме времени создания, PowerShell также позволяет вам получать доступ к другим важным атрибутам файла, таким как LastAccessTimeUtc и LastWriteTimeUtc. Это позволяет получить полное представление о временных отметках файла и его истории.

Заключение

Атрибуты времени файлов играют важную роль в управлении данными и обеспечении их целостности. Важно понимать различия между файловыми системами, такими как ExFAT и NTFS, чтобы выбрать подходящее решение для своих нужд. Использование PowerShell предоставляет удобный способ для просмотра и анализа этих временных атрибутов на ваших устройствах с Windows. Таким образом, вы сможете более эффективно управлять своими файлами и следить за их состоянием.

Источник

Ответить

Ваш адрес email не будет опубликован. Обязательные поля помечены *